Commercial Description:
This copper-colored ale has an intense bitterness and a floral hop aroma. It is higher in alcohol than our other beers. Hops added during aging contribute to its distinct dryness.

Tap at the High Point brewpub on 2/3/08: Pours a transparent dark golden bronze with a well-lacing white head. Aroma of lightly sweet toasty pale malts and a touch of piny hops. Body starts fairly full with a nice malty sweetness balanced with fresh resiny bittering hops before a crisp bittersweet finish. A decent IPA and quite drinkable.

Appearance: Lightly hazy, copper body with a small, white head. Smell: Light pale malts and a dash of grapefruit juice. Taste: Pale maltiness with a subtle sweetness. Light citrus rind character. Medium hop bitterness that lingers into the finish. Mouthfeel: Medium-thin body. Medium carbonation. Drinkability: A simple, straight-forward brewpub India Pale Ale.
